    Stopped by to grab something for dinner. Walked in front door, ordered, and waited about 15 minutes in the car with a beeper to signal when order was ready. Got a pound of brisket and a large container of mac and cheese. Pick up at the side window. Made for a perfect dinner for two. The next day used the remaining brisket as topping for a Panera pizza. The fat is so delicious that I ate it and took an extra cholesterol pill afterwards. Oh yeah forgot to mention the covered outdoor patio with picnic tables if one wants to eat on location. It's a nice addition to the space and far enough away from the roadway so car sounds are tolerable.
